Microwave Photonics, Second Edition systematically introduces important technologies and applications in this emerging field. It also reviews recent advances in micro- and millimeter-wavelength and terahertz-frequency systems. Leading international researchers examine wave generation, measurement, detection, control, and propagation, as well as the devices and components that enable ultrawide-band and ultrafast transmission, switching, and signal processing.
The contributors, many of whom are pioneers in the field, explore the theory, techniques, and technologies that are fueling applications such as radio-over-fiber, injection-locked semiconductor lasers, and terahertz photon-ics. Throughout, they share insights on overcoming current limitations and on potential developments.
